TYPE OF DRILL/ TRAINING ELEMENTS INVOLVED


(Boat Drill / Fire Drill / Oil Spill / Man over board / others)

15:15 – 15:40 General alarm sounded. Announced trough Public System – ABANDON
SHIP DRILL. The crew with life jackets and immersion suites mustered at Muster Station -
head count conducted. Checked duty knowledge of all crew. Checked life jackets were
correctly donned. New crew members familiarized with LSA. All crew was instructed on how
to equip Immersion Suit and Life Jacket properly. Deck Cadet demonstrated how to dress
Immersion Suits and Life Jacket. All crew members boarded the life-boat & took their seats .
Procedure for launching life boat discussed . Info for the crew about Lifeboat on-board
equipment, including release system and steering gear. After that engine tested
(ahead/astern) and crew was shown how to start . Lifeboat was closed, crew proceeded to
the life rafts and rescue boat. Rescue boat engine tested . 3/Off explained procedure for
operating the survival craft cran. Drill completed.
